Description


Maintenance Technician (HVAC Certified) 

Department: Operations 

Reports to: Property Manager 

Location: Spring Creek Townhomes - Springfield, IL

What You’ll Do:

  • Perform preventive maintenance and repairs on HVAC systems, mechanical systems, and building structures 
  • Participate in on-call for after-hours emergencies. 
  • Troubleshoot and respond to service requests efficiently and professionally 
  • Inspect equipment and facilities to ensure safety and operational readiness 
  • Maintain tools, equipment, and inventory of supplies 
  • Prepare reports, logs, and service documentation 
  • Assist with renovation and construction projects as needed 
  • Ensure compliance with safety standards and company policies 

Requirements


What You’ll Bring:

  • HVAC certification required- Type 2 or EPA Universal
  • 4+ years of maintenance experience, with at least 3 years in a trade-specific role 
  • Strong knowledge of building systems, tools, and safety procedures 
  • Ability to lift up to 70 lbs and work in physically demanding environments 
  • Comfortable working at heights, in confined spaces, and in varying weather conditions 
  • Excellent communication skills 
  • Ability to read and follow written and verbal instructions 
  • A proactive, team-oriented mindset 


Additional Details:

  • High school diploma or GED required 
  • Work may be performed on rooftops and require use of ladders or lift devices 
  • Work environment involves some exposure to hazards or physical risks, which require following basic safety precautions 
  • Nolan Living is proud to be an Equal Opportunity Employer 
  • Background check and E-Verify required
